Hungry folks on their way out to Salem Willows will want to stop by Ruthy's Kitchen for its wide variety of made-to-order dishes. Regulars swear by the mac n' cheese. This cozy three-year-old cafe was named after the owner and head cook's mother. The menu caters to special dietary needs, i.e. gluten-free and low sodium.
